gpt4 book ai didi

javascript - XHR性能

转载 作者:行者123 更新时间:2023-12-03 10:34:16 25 4
gpt4 key购买 nike

我正在开发一个 js 应用程序,它加载存储在另一台服务器中的一些 xml 文件。我当然使用 XHR 来加载和访问他们的内容。

作为第一级,我只访问包含元素名称的顶级文件,并以缩略图格式显示它们。我的想法是显示文件的标题以及每个元素包含的项目数。另外,在第二级中,当用户单击其中一个元素(缩略图)时,我会加载所单击元素的内容。因此,我在徘徊我的过程是否高性能,因为我第一次加载或访问文件两次时显示元素包含的项目数,第二次当用户单击该元素时显示其内容。

请问你觉得怎么样?还有其他好的解决方案吗?非常感谢您的回答:)

最佳答案

在本来可以发出一个 HTTP 请求的地方发出两个 HTTP 请求通常不太理想。当然,如果浏览器可以满足缓存中的第二个请求,甚至无需对源服务器进行重新验证查询,那么“位”确实可能非常小,但肯定会花费更长的时间。

做什么取决于你。如果您在使用响应创建缩略图后保留响应的副本,则会使用更多内存;如果您不这样做并向服务器发出第二个请求,那么您所做的事情可能会稍微慢一些。

拿走你的钱,做出你的选择。

关于javascript - XHR性能,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29077213/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com